New Regulations for Foreign Banks and Financial Institutions in Nepal
The Rastral Bank of Nepal has introduced new regulations for foreign banks and financial institutions seeking to operate in the country. The regulations aim to ensure that these institutions comply with the necessary requirements before obtaining prior approval from the bank.
Requirements for Prior Approval
To obtain prior approval, foreign banks and financial institutions must submit certain documents and details to the Rastral Bank. These include:
- Written commitment from their board of directors stating that they will make available funds necessary to fulfill their liabilities related to business activities in Nepal
- Details about the location of their proposed branch office
- Information about possible office bearers
The Rastral Bank may demand additional documents or details while carrying out an inquiry into the submitted documents and details.
Approval Process
The Rastral Bank may grant prior approval for a foreign bank or financial institution to open a branch office in Nepal within 120 days of filing the application. Once approved, the foreign bank or financial institution must register its branch office according to prevailing laws relating to companies.
Additionally, the branch office must submit an application to the Rastral Bank along with required documents and details, as well as pay a prescribed fee for approval to carry out banking and financial transactions in Nepal.
Terms and Conditions
The Rastral Bank may prescribe necessary terms and conditions while granting approval. The bank may also grant approval within 90 days of filing the application.
